Get a recommendation from your local s2ki forum on a good shop in your area. Modern computerized alignment machines will have your specific car's recommended alignment specs...those are fine unless you want something specific for racing.
If tire wear isn't a big concern, you could try a little more negative camber.
Ask them for the before and after printout. One time I was getting tires put on and the store asked if I wanted my alignment checked. I said fine. They came at me with an $80 bill and I asked to see the specs.
They didn't change a thing (nothing needed) so I showed the manager and asked, "You're really going to charge me for that?"
They waived the charge.
